Abstract
the antarctic oscillation aao is a leading teleconnection pattern in the southern hemisphere circulation it is calculated as the first empirical orthogonal function eof for height anomalies poleward of 20 degrees latitude for the southern hemisphere the goal of the eof procedure is to capture the maximum amount of explained variance in the circulation fields
